Dress Code 

School Dress Code Attire

WOLCS has chosen the following school attire for our students in order to promote a positive and appropriate school appearance. We require students to follow these policies along with parental/family support.


School administration reserves the right and privilege to clarify and/or make the final judgment of policy and student appearance. School clothing and/or the general appearance of a WOLCS student should be modest, neat, well fitted and in good taste to uphold biblical teachings. School attire should not call for undue or distracting attention.

School Attire for Girls

WOLCS Logo Polo Shirts (navy, gold, gray) must be purchased from the school during WOLCS’ Uniform Sales or from our approved third party vendor, Easy Print Tees 13359 Foothill Blvd., Fontana 92335 Phone: (909) 463-3770

Jumpers, Skirts, Skorts, Pants, Capris and Shorts (navy or khaki) may be purchased from the school uniform section of your favorite store.

Shorts – fingertip length or longer

Skirts and jumpers may be no shorter than 3” above the knee when kneeling

Shorts or leggings must be worn under skirts and jumpers.

Shoes: Tennis shoes or other athletic type shoes suitable for play worn with socks.

Outerwear Jackets, sweaters and sweatshirts must be school approved solid colors such as navy, gray, white and beige. WOLCS’ sweat jackets/pullovers are permitted or jackets in school colors only. Zip up or pullover hoodies that bear sports teams, name/sports brands or designs are not permitted.


School Attire for Boys

WOLCS Logo Polo Shirts (navy, gold, gray) must be purchased from the school during WOLCS’ Uniform Sales or from our approved third party vendor, Easy Print Tees 13359 Foothill Blvd., Fontana 92335 Phone: (909) 463-3770

Pants and Shorts (navy or khaki) may be purchased from the school uniform section of your favorite store.

Long pants including cargo pants

Shorts - mid-thigh length or longer

Shoes: Tennis shoes or other athletic type shoes suitable for play worn with socks

Outerwear: Jackets, sweaters and sweatshirts must be school approved solid colors such as navy blue, gray, white and beige. WOLCS’ sweat jackets/pullovers are permitted or jackets in school colors only. Zip up or pullover hoodies that bear sports teams, name/sports brands or designs are not permitted.


Middle School P.E. Dress

The regular dress for PE is the WOLCS issued P.E. t-shirt with shorts. Students must also wear tennis shoes during P.E. Students will be required to dress out in their PE uniforms on free dress days.


Field trips

All students must wear WOLCS gold polo shirts on field trips.


General guidelines every school day: 

There should be no extreme or unnatural hair color or hairstyles.

Pants, shorts, skirts or skorts are to be worn at the waist level (above the hip bone). No baggy or tight fitting clothing is allowed.

Underclothes must be covered at all times.

Tops must cover the midriff at all times.

Hats and/or sunglasses are not to be worn indoors.

Earrings:

For boys - no earrings are acceptable

For girls - small stud-type earrings that lay flat against the ear are acceptable

Girls must wear play shorts underneath their skirts or jumpers while on any play equipment.


General Guidelines Free Dress Days:

Students are allowed to wear free dress as indicated on specified dates on the school calendar.

In addition to the above guidelines the following apply to free dress:

Jeans are permitted but they must not be ripped, torn or have holes. 

T-shirts are to be free of inappropriate wording, images, logos or non-Christian bands.

No open-toed shoes, slippers or flip flops are allowed for reasons of playground safety.

Leggings must be worn only with tops that are fingertip to knee length. No yoga pants with short, or cropped t-shirts. T-shirts must come just above the knee.

Middle School students will be required to dress out in their PE uniforms on free dress days.

School Dress Violations:

Students who come to school out of dress code will be directed to the administration office and parent(s) will be contacted to bring appropriate school uniform/attire. Students will not be allowed to return to the classroom until they are in proper school uniform/attire.
